Hosted by WBEC-West | Colorado Forum
Date: November 13, 2025
Time: 4:00 PM – 6:00 PM MST
Location: Epic Campus, 190 E Littleton Blvd, Littleton, CO 80121 (In-Person Event)
Erin Dougan, from the WBEC-West Colorado Forum and TalenTrust, alongside, Ale Spray, President and CEO of Hispanic Contractors of Colorado, will lead an engaging conversation breaking down the latest labor market and economic trends for business leaders. We will also hear from Beth Best of the EPIC Campus team and learn about their exciting Entrepreneurship program.
This event creates a space for open discussion and collaboration among local business owners and community leaders who are shaping Colorado’s economic future.
